Cotton Season: Cotton Sales In Zimbabwe Are Higher Than In The Same Period Last Year.

Cotton sales in Zimbabwe increased during the cotton season than in the same period last year, which is due to the early settlement of producer prices, an official said on Monday. According to the latest data released by the agricultural marketing Bureau, Zimbabwe has sold 41907690 kilograms of cotton since the beginning of the distribution season in April this year, the Zimbabwe news agency reported.


Last year, from the start of the selling season to the end of 7, Zimbabwe sold 34900 tons of cotton because of the price deadlock between growers and wholesalers. This year, the cotton mills and farmers agreed to a minimum price of 0.35 US dollars / kg.


"Any competition from buyers or associations will lead to a firm action by the agricultural marketing Bureau," said Roger mhtag, chief executive of the Zimbabwe agricultural marketing Bureau. Once farmers have fulfilled their contractual obligations, the agricultural marketing Bureau encourages competition in public procurement sites. The agricultural sales bureau is a statutory body established under the laws of the Congress and authorized to manage the production, procurement and processing of agricultural products in Zimbabwe.


MHT said the seed cotton contract was based on quantity and was formulated in accordance with the provisions of law 63 of 2011. Farmers have not been able to sell their free cotton to the company at the highest price. Purchasers are allowed to buy their subsidized cotton seeds or buy them from public procurement sites. At present, the purchase price of seed cotton purchased by purchasers is US $0.38 US $-0.40 / kg.


Last year, the government of Zimbabwe intervened to fix the price of cotton producers at $1.50 / kg, even though the cotton mill refused to comply with the price of 0.35 US dollars per kilogram. At present, some cotton producers have begun to turn to other cash crops. Many farmers in West Marshall province have turned to soybeans and corn because they are disappointed with the 2012 economic season. Mhhaha said total cotton sales this year may be down compared with last year.
